A lot of people in Minecraft make some pretty cool things. This article will show you how to make a working fridge in Minecraft that you can even put food in.
Steps
-
Place an iron door.
-
Place any block next to it. Then, put a piece of redstone on top.Advertisement
-
Place a lever on that block, too.
-
Make sure the door opens outwards, not inwards.
-
Place any two blocks two spaces behind the door.
-
Put dispensers on the blocks.
-
Put food in the dispensers.
-
Close the door.
-
Mine the blocks behind the dispenser.
-
Enjoy your new fridge!

QuestionHow do I download a texture pack?MelodyTongyuCommunity AnswerFind the texture pack online and download it. Then, unzip it. Then press the Windows button + R, type %AppData%, then hit Enter. Click Roaming followed by .minecraft. Then, open the resourcepacks folder. Place the unzipped texture pack inside, and you're done! If you can't find the resourcepacks folder, create a folder called resourcepacks.
